Jeff is a first chair litigator who litigates complex commercial disputes and provides comprehensive risk mitigation counseling to clients across a range of sectors. He is experienced with matters involving mergers and acquisitions, partnerships, fiduciary duties, commercial real estate transactions, franchise and distribution systems, restrictive covenants, and other sophisticated contractual issues. 

Jeff’s practice also extends into the realm of insurance law, where he provides counsel and litigates statutory and common law bad faith claims. His experience encompasses both first-party and third-party insurance disputes, where he has successfully guided clients through the complexities of insurance litigation, ensuring their rights are protected and claims are effectively addressed.

While Jeff regularly appears before state and federal courts throughout the U.S. and in arbitrations, he also keenly focuses on early dispute resolution. He cuts to the core of matter, evaluating key issues and finding the most efficient pathway to achieving his clients’ goals. His clients appreciate this approach, which aims to safeguard their interests while avoiding, if possible, litigation expenses and exposure.
